Never used Priceline before. It appears that I can't just pick any hotel that I want. What did you put in to bid on this hotel? What star rating?

You can't pick and choose the exact hotel you want. When you first start to make you offer you pick 1 star-2 star 3-star and above etc up to a 5 star level. You are stuck with what you get, and most of the times the rooms even get upgraded by the time I check in. Been my luck anyway. Stayed in a many of 400 dollar a night rooms for 90-120 bucks all over.

Start low and keep checking, then again the next day or so. If you can wait them out, something will fall for you.
